Output e50d32df8421b85e19f2286b31cf0fc2dccff2783a5f9282fafa4b65df669c0a:13

value
1554859
script pubkey
OP_0 OP_PUSHBYTES_20 18078b650c53e5d85bc708bec50400b3dd244646
address
bc1qrqrckegv20jask78pzlv2pqqk0wjg3jxp6mhnj
transaction
e50d32df8421b85e19f2286b31cf0fc2dccff2783a5f9282fafa4b65df669c0a
spent
true